Remote Microsoft Full Stack Developer information

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Remote Microsoft Full Stack Developer,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Remote Microsoft Full Stack Developer, you need strong proficiency in both front-end (e.g., HTML, CSS, JavaScript, React or Angular) and back-end (e.g., C#, .NET, SQL Server) Microsoft technologies, along with a relevant degree or equivalent experience. Familiarity with cloud platforms like Azure, version control systems such as Git, and certifications like Microsoft Certified: Azure Developer Associate are highly valuable. Excellent problem-solving, remote collaboration, and communication skills help you deliver projects efficiently and work effectively within distributed teams. These skills and qualifications are crucial for building robust, scalable solutions and ensuring seamless teamwork in a remote development environment.

How do Remote Microsoft Full Stack Developers typically collaborate with distributed teams and ensure project alignment?

Remote Microsoft Full Stack Developers frequently use collaboration tools like Microsoft Teams, Azure DevOps, and GitHub to communicate with team members, track progress, and align on project goals. Regular virtual stand-up meetings, code reviews, and shared documentation help maintain transparency and synchronize workflows. Effective time management and proactive communication are essential, as teams may span multiple time zones. Developers are encouraged to ask questions, participate in planning sessions, and leverage shared repositories to stay connected and productive.

What is a Remote Microsoft Full Stack Developer?

A Remote Microsoft Full Stack Developer is a software engineer who specializes in building both the front-end and back-end components of applications using Microsoft technologies, such as .NET, C#, ASP.NET, and SQL Server. 'Remote' means they work from a location outside of the employer's office, often from home or another remote location. These developers are proficient in designing, developing, and maintaining web applications, ensuring seamless integration between client-side and server-side logic. They also collaborate with teams using cloud services like Azure and tools like Visual Studio. This role requires strong problem-solving skills and the ability to work independently while communicating effectively with distributed teams.

What We Look For In a JavaScript Tutor
  • Advanced Subject Mastery: Deep knowledge of JavaScript syntax, DOM manipulation, event handling, asynchronous programming with promises and async/await, ES6+ features, closures, prototypal inheritance, fetch API, and popular frameworks including React and Node.js. Ability to explain callback functions, scope and hoisting, and the event loop while preparing students for web development careers and full-stack engineering coursework.
  • Conceptual Teaching & Problem-Solving: Skilled at breaking down asynchronous programming patterns, DOM traversal, and component-based architecture. Guides students through building interactive web pages, handling user events, fetching API data, implementing state management, and debugging browser console errors. Emphasizes practical web development skills and connects JavaScript to front-end frameworks, server-side Node.js development, and modern web application architecture.
  • Curriculum Awareness & Adaptive Instruction: Familiar with JavaScript curricula and common challenges such as understanding asynchronous behavior, scope confusion, and the this keyword context. Adapts instruction using browser developer tools, interactive coding exercises, and project-based web development to support students from introductory web programming through advanced front-end and full-stack JavaScript development.
